Development of a stepwise [3 + 3] annelation to functionalized piperidines
Katharine M Goodenough1, Piotr Raubo, Joseph P A Harrity
1Department of Chemistry, University of Sheffield, Brook Hill, UK.
Abstract:
[reaction: see text] A stepwise formal [3 + 3] cycloaddition sequence via a Grignard addition-cyclization reaction leads to a much improved piperidine synthesis. This methodology provides improved flexibility in both the aziridine substrate and TMM equivalent.
